We are seeking a dedicated IT Support Specialist to join our team in Stockton-on-Tees. This permanent, full-time role is essential for ensuring the smooth operation of our IT systems and providing exceptional support to our staff. The ideal candidate will possess a strong technical background and a passion for problem-solving, contributing to the overall efficiency and effectiveness of our IT services.
Outline of Responsibilities:
- Provide first-line support for IT-related issues, including hardware, software, and network problems.
- Diagnose and resolve technical issues in a timely manner, ensuring minimal disruption to business operations.
- Assist in the installation, configuration, and maintenance of IT equipment and software.
- Maintain accurate records of support requests and resolutions using the helpdesk system.
- Collaborate with other IT team members to implement system upgrades and improvements.
- Educate staff on best practices for IT usage and security protocols.
- Participate in IT projects and initiatives as required.
Qualifications:
- Associate degree in Information Technology (desirable not essential), Computer Science, or a related field.
- Strong knowledge of Office 365, MS SQL, MS Dynamics, Microsoft Operating systems & server structures including Active Directory, Intune.
- Excellent knowledge of IT Security infrastructure and implementation.
- Networking experience - IP addressing, DNS, DHCP, VPN, WIFI, cabling & infrastructure.
- Project management experience.
- Proven experience in an IT support role or similar position.
- Strong understanding of computer systems, mobile devices, and other technology.
- Excellent problem-solving skills and the ability to work under pressure.
- Excellent communication skills, both verbal and written.
- Familiarity with helpdesk software and remote support tools.
- Ability to apply new technologies for use within the company.
- A commitment to continuous learning and professional development.
- Supporting the attainment of company targets.
- Works on own initiative in a proactive way.
